Elisa Landauro-Johnston is a seasoned professional with extensive experience in client care and counseling. Currently serving as the Client Care Program Manager at Ceres Community Project since May 2019, Elisa has also held positions as a Lead Client Care Coordinator and Bilingual Client Care Coordinator. Prior to this role, Elisa worked as an Intake Coordinator at Side by Side from May 2017 to April 2019 and served as a Credit and Debt Coach for SparkPoint Marin at Community Action Marin from 2015 to October 2016. Furthermore, Elisa accumulated significant experience at CCCS of San Francisco from 2003 to October 2016 as a Certified Credit and Housing Counselor and Housing Counselor. Elisa holds a degree from Universidad de San Martín de Porres, completed from 1984 to 1989.

Ceres Community Project is a non-profit organization that mentors teen chefs and gardeners to grow and cook 100% organic food for people facing a serious illness like cancer, diabetes or heart disease. Our meals are medically tailored, designed to help people manage their specific illness or condition. We advocate for a healthy, just, caring and sustainable world. We partner with healthcare providers and insurers to demonstrate the impact of medically-tailored meals and make access to these meals a routine part of healthcare through pilots or medical studies. Ceres trains other organizations to recreate our soil to community health model across the United States and in Denmark with our affiliate partner program.
